Transcriptome atlas of Striga germination: Implications for managing an intractable parasitic plant
Societal Impact Statement Witchweeds, parasitic plants of the genus Striga, are nicknamed “cereal killers” because of their devastating destruction of Africa's most staple cereals, including maize, sorghum, millets, and upland rice. The parasite relies on biomolecules emitted from the host root...
